Why do you get gallstones?

The cause of gallstones is a mystery that scientists still haven't figured out. But to put it simply, it's because the components in bile are "in the wrong car". The proportions of cholesterol, bile salts, and phospholipids are not right, and the bile flow is not smooth, which makes it easy to form gallstones. There are several types of gallstones, including cholesterol stones, bile pigment stones, and mixed types.

What are the symptoms of gallstones?

Some people with gallstones will suddenly have severe stomach pain, especially after eating greasy food; others will feel bloated and nauseous, and their stool may have a strange smell. But some people don't feel anything until they find out during a physical examination. However, don't underestimate it, as gallstones can also cause serious diseases such as acute pancreatitis and cholecystitis.

To treat or not to treat? To remove the gallbladder or to preserve it?

When it comes to gallstones, many people are confused: should they remove the gallbladder and put an end to all problems, or should they preserve the gallbladder and remove the stones? In fact, it depends on the specific situation.

Gallbladder removal : In the past, gallbladder removal was the mainstream, especially for patients with recurrent biliary colic and complications of gallstones. However, gallbladder removal is not the end of the world. Sometimes, acid reflux, heartburn, diarrhea and other discomforts may occur.

Gallbladder preservation and lithotripsy : With the development of technology, gallbladder preservation and lithotripsy are becoming more and more popular. As long as the gallbladder function is good and there is a strong desire to preserve the gallbladder, you can try it. But remember, gallbladder preservation is not a casual thing. Certain conditions must be met, such as the gallbladder wall is not thick and the contraction function is normal.

Will the disease recur after gallbladder preservation and stone removal?

To be honest, recurrence is still possible after gallbladder preservation and stone removal, but the recurrence rate is not high, generally around 5%-8%. To prevent recurrence, the stones must be removed cleanly during surgery, and lifestyle habits must be changed after surgery, such as eating less greasy food and exercising more. If recurrence occurs, as long as the gallbladder still meets the conditions, gallbladder preservation and stone removal can be performed again.

What are the side effects of having a gallbladder removed?

Although the gallbladder is a small organ, it plays a big role. After removing the gallbladder, some people will experience indigestion, diarrhea and other problems. Moreover, in the long run, it may increase the risk of fatty liver, cirrhosis and even colorectal cancer. Therefore, it is best not to remove it unless the gallbladder is already very damaged.
